DVDWorldUSA.comSome region 1 titles from Columbia Tristar have an encoding called 'Regional Coding Enhancement' (RCE). This will prevent the DVD from playing on some multi-region or region-free DVD players. In general, any multi-region player that has the option for you to manually choose the regional setting will not be affected by RCE. PlayUSA.com: DVDsRegion Coding Enhancement (abbreviated as RCE on our site) is the practice of additional region protection software applied to R1 DVDs to prevent them from being viewed by non-R1 machines. Currently only the Columbia and Warner studios actively pursue this policy. Not all so-called ?multi-region? players are compliant with this software so we strongly advise that you check with your machine?s specifications before ordering these titles.

faq techRegional Coding enhancement (RCE) is an additional layer of protection which some studios have placed on certain DVDs to prevent them from playing on region-free or multi-region players. RCE is something completely different than region coding - It's an additional piece of programming on the DVD that checks to see if your DVD player is set to 'no region' ... if it is, it stops playing the DVD.

gtk-gnutella - The Graphical Unix Gnutella Clientgtk-gnutella use UTF-8 as default encoding for filenames. If your locale setting does not use UTF-8, other applications may not display these filenames correctly or may have problems accessing them in the worst case. You can change the encoding using the environment variable G_FILENAME_ENCODING. This affects most applications that use Gtk+ or GLib.

ukRCE is a way devised by some of the major film studies to prevent DVDs playing on players that have been modified to play DVDs from regions other then the region of purchase. In reality RCE is little more then a mechanism designed to trick you player into admitting it's not a genuine Region (X) player. Similar systems have been used by Disney in the past and all of these systems can be avoided if your player has an option to manually set the region.

FAQs About Buying A DVD Player - TimeForDVD.comRegion Code Enhancement (RCE) is just that, an enhancement to the region code idea. In our answer to the previous question, we discussed that there are region-free DVD players that have been modified after-market by third-party vendors to evade the region code restriction. To counter that, the DVD format now includes a stricter mechanism called Region Code Enhancement. The region code is now embedded in the digital bitstream so it becomes harder to foil by region-free DVD players.

www.adobians.comURL Encoding is a process of transforming user input to a CGI form so it is fit for travel across the network -- basically, stripping spaces and punctuation and replacing with escape characters. URL Decoding is the reverse process. To perform these operations, call java.net.URLEncoder.encode() and java.net.URLDecoder.decode() (the latter was (finally!) added to JDK 1.2, aka Java 2). URL Rewriting is a technique for saving state information on the user's browser between page hits.
